Denver Pet Partners has operated its flagship program at Swedish Medical Center in Englewood, CO for 16 years. For many years, the Swedish Medical Center Auxiliary generously supported our training services by providing grants to help offset the purchase of the manuals used to train new handlers how to effectively deliver Animal-Assisted Interventions to clients.
Rocky Vista University (RVU) College of Osteopathic Medicine is a private medical school with locations in Parker, CO and Ivins, UT.
The Parker, CO campus generously donates space to Denver Pet Partners to conduct meetings and Team evaluations several times per year.
As a member of the SCL Health System, Platte Valley Medical Center (PVMC) has been designated one of the world’s most patient-centered hospitals by Planetree, Inc. Platte Valley’s 10 Pillars of Healing are incorporated into every patient experience. They include integrative therapies, human interactions, support networks, healing design, education and information, healthy and delicious meals, healing art therapy, spirituality, healing touch, and healthy communities to help patients recover.
PVMC generously donates space to Denver Pet Partners to conduct both Handler Training Workshops and Team Evaluations.
